Yeonggwang-gun Accelerates Preparations for e-Mobility Expo
[Yeonggwang=Asia Economy Honam Reporting Headquarters Reporter Lee Jeonseong] Yeonggwang-gun, Jeollanam-do is making final preparations for the successful hosting of the 2022 Yeonggwang e-Mobility Expo, which will be held at Yeonggwang Sportium from the 13th to the 16th of next month.
According to the county on the 30th, the e-Mobility Expo, themed "Evolution of Mobility, Small but Bigger Future, e-Mobility!", will be held after being canceled twice due to COVID-19, promising to present a richer and more abundant array of attractions.
Famous singers such as Jang Minho, Forestella, Park Jindo, and Seol Hayoon will brighten the opening ceremony with celebratory performances, and on Saturday the 15th, there will be a live broadcast of Lim Baekcheon’s Baek Music and a Black Eagles airshow, providing special spectacles.
120 e-mobility companies from 20 countries will exhibit and offer discounts on various products, and various e-mobility experience zones where visitors can directly ride the vehicles will be set up. Every afternoon, there will be prize draws for e-mobility products and more, offering special enjoyment to visitors.
Additionally, events such as the University Student Smart e-Mobility Competition, Future Talent Science Festival, and Glory Maker Festival are being well prepared for students to participate in and experience firsthand.
Moreover, diverse side events that will satisfy visitors, including an e-Mobility parade, robot and drone exhibitions and experiences, discounted sales of e-mobility products, and prize draws, will be presented.
